This glorious 8.4 mile ride takes us through some of Bolton’s wonderful scenery and unknown sculptures. We begin at Leverhulme Park Community Leisure Centre riding past the Athletics Stadium and south through the park. Cycling in the suburb of Darcy Lever we meander our way down between the tree-lined off-road trail towards Moses Gate Country Park, viewing some of Bolton’s hidden sculptures and whisking past the River Croal. We cross over into Moses Gate Country Park and meander between the River Croal and the Manchester, Bolton and Bury Canal at Knob End. Here we cycle over the wonderfully constructed Meccano Bridge. Designed by Liam Curtin the six-tonne bridge is made entirely of 400 over-sized meccano pieces and 700 nuts and bolts. Over Meccano Bridge we continue along the canal, past Dingle Reservoir before turning north towards the outskirts of Radcliffe and then west towards Little Lever. Continuing on suburban roads we return towards Moses Gate Country Park taking an alternative route back through the park before returning through Knob End, Darcy Lever and back into Leverhulme Park. If you’re fairly confident on your bike and ready to broaden your cycling horizons, our Steady rides are ideal. At a comfortable pace, and possibly with some modest hills along the way, rides take place on mainly quiet roads with plenty of sights along the way. Rides are between 6 and 20 miles long, at a moderate pace of between 7 and 10 miles an hour.
